  This heart-warming feature was published in My Weekly magazine in February 2020, reaching readers across the UK.  Briony Smith has devoted her life to Making A Difference to the planet by saving endangered big cats   Little Heroes, Koshi and Khumbu Melt Hearts and Bring Hope    Two adorable snow leopard cubs have a big destiny. When they grow up they will help protect this vulnerable species.   Beautiful brothers, Khumbu and Koshi were born nine months ago at The Big Cat Sanctuary in the heart of the Kent countryside.   The cubs were born to fiercely protective mum, Laila and laid-back dad, Yarko after four years of desperately trying to breed from the precious pair.     Head Keeper, Briony Smith, 35, explains that Laila and Yarko came to the sanctuary as part of the European Endangered Species Programme.   Kimona Ward at 34 is living proof that a criminal record does not have to stigmatise you for life. Her inspirational success after doing time for drug dealing is a true story of redemption.   Born and raised in Kingston, Jamaica, Kimona grew up independent and resilient.   She had to be strong. Abandoned by her parents as a baby at the tender age of one, she was left in the care of her kind-hearted grandmother in a sprawling house filled with aunts and uncles, her stepfather, two older brothers and an abundance of boisterous cousins.   Little Kim cultivated a tough protective layer and insulated her vulnerability when pinned down and punched, kicked and bitten by the other kids or when an uncle flew into a hateful rage and beat her.   She recalls: “Another uncle verbally abused me, saying I wouldn't turn out to be anything because my parents left me.
